Police Officer Edward L. Spielman
Chicago and Northwestern Railroad Police Department
Railroad Police

End of Watch: Monday, April 8, 1912

Officer Edward Spielman was shot and killed in the Proviso yards in Chicago, Illinois.

Officer Spielman was a brother-in-law of Officer John Camphouse who was shot and killed less than 200 feet away in the same yards on November 2, 1912.
